As stated in Board staff's 7 August 2001 letter, Triple E must abandon monitoring wells <br /> according to San Joaquin County requirements that are in areas susceptible to damage <br /> from the new housing development construction activities. However, if abandoning is <br /> required of wells MW-2 or MW-7, a replacement monitoring well must be installed once <br /> the area is developed. Furthermore, groundwater samples need to be collected prior to <br /> abandoning any site well. <br /> Attached for your review and comment is a draft MRP.
